Illegal export of agricultural products through occupied Crimea: Captain of vessel arrested in port of Reni was served notice of suspicion. PHOTO

The captain of the foreign vessel USKO MFU, which was exporting agricultural products through the closed seaports of the occupied Crimean peninsula, was served a notice of suspicion in absentia.”, — write: censor.net
